    Student Council (SC)

    Do you know what's the authority of the Council?

    The Student Council (SC) is one of the central participatory bodies of Wageningen University. Organisationally, the SC is at the same level as the University Board (i.e. Executive Board). It consists of 12 students that represent the interests of students. The SC voices the needs of all students to the Executive Board and advises on plans and policies of the university. The members of the Student Council are elected every year in spring, and dedicate a full-time year to the Council.

    SC Election

     Make sure to use your voting right!

    The Student Council elections are held every year in spring. In many ways, the Student Council’s work is not so different from the Dutch political system. In total 12 seats are available to be taken by different parties or independent members. Depending on the number of votes received during the elections, the seats are divided over the parties and appointed to independent members.
